Sunnyside Sliced, a cult-favourite pizzeria known for New York-style pizzas, opens a second slice shop. Multiple outlets report the business is taking its supersized pizza offering to a new location described as an “under-serviced” area on the edge of the city. While the articles do not present differing claims about the concept or the move, they frame the new outlet as an unexpected expansion beyond the pizzeria’s existing footprint. All sources describe the second shop as focused on selling slices, bringing Sunnyside Sliced’s established pizza style to a different neighbourhood rather than opening in a more central or expected area. The coverage emphasizes that the new store is part of the brand’s growth strategy and extends access to its large New York-style pizzas for customers in the area.
